Networking

 

This entire section applies ONLY if you are running The Ultimate on multiple workstations within a store.  It is enclosed in the documentation folder of your installed The Ultimate system.

The Ultimate software will operate on from 1 - 30 workstations.  Almost ANY networking system will work.  This includes ALL versions of Microsoft Windows using the enclosed Windows networking system.

A peer to peer network is recommended.  This means, if you desire to have 3 workstations, then only 3 computers are necessary, not an extra one to act strictly as the "server".  Simply pick one of the computers to be your server, and the rest will be workstations.

There are two ways to install The Ultimate on your existing network:

1.  Only install The Ultimate on the server, and run the workstations by pointing to the server's hard drive.

2.   Install The Ultimate on ALL computers, while instructing each workstation to look to the server for only the data.  (Recommended)

 

SOME NETWORKING TIPS:

  • Make sure you share the server's hard drive for FULL access.  We recommend that the complete hard drive be shared, not just the ULTIMATE folder.

  • Map the server's hard drive on each workstation.  Assign a free drive letter to the mapped drive.  For instructions on mapping a drive, press <F1> on your desktop and do an Index search for "mapping drive letters"  When the drive is mapped successfully, you will see the drive appear on the My Computer screen.

  • If you enter The Ultimate and the Demonstration Store (999) appears instead of your store, then it means that your workstation has temporarily lost it's mapping of the server's hard drive.  This can be a common occurrence if the workstation is powered up before the server.  You will need to map the server's hard drive once again.
